A leading recruitment agency is seeking a Graduate / Trainee Mechanical Design Engineer based in Rochdale, UK. The role offers full training and involves hands-on SolidWorks design work, participation in the complete design cycle, and collaboration with a team of engineers.

The ideal candidate will be a graduate in mechanical engineering or a related field with proficiency in SolidWorks.

The position offers a salary range of £25,000–£30,000 plus progression opportunities and benefits.

How to prepare for a job interview at Ernest Gordon Recruitment Limited

✨Know Your SolidWorks Inside Out

Make sure you brush up on your SolidWorks skills before the interview. Familiarise yourself with the latest features and be ready to discuss any projects you've worked on using the software. Being able to demonstrate your proficiency will show that you're serious about the role.

✨Understand the Design Cycle

Since the job involves participation in the complete design cycle, it’s crucial to understand each phase. Be prepared to talk about how you approach design challenges and what steps you take from concept to completion. This will highlight your problem-solving skills and teamwork abilities.

✨Show Enthusiasm for Learning

As a graduate, it's important to convey your eagerness to learn and grow within the company. Share examples of how you've taken initiative in your studies or previous roles to develop your skills. This will resonate well with employers looking for trainees who are keen to progress.

✨Prepare Questions for the Interviewers

Having thoughtful questions ready shows that you’re genuinely interested in the role and the company. Ask about the team dynamics, training opportunities, or specific projects you might be involved in. This not only helps you gauge if the company is the right fit but also leaves a positive impression.
